Transit visa, short stay ...
Egypt > Turkey
-
Turkish representation in Egypt
-
Embassy of Turkey in Cairo
Transit visa, short stay ... Egypt Ukraine
Transit visa, short stay ... Egypt Uruguay
Transit visa, short stay ... Egypt Vanuatu
Transit visa, short stay ... Egypt Vatican
Transit visa, short stay ... Egypt Venezuela